Complete Tax Breakdown

Detailed line-by-line tax calculation for a Conservation Scientists earning $69,100 in Arizona (single filer, standard deduction).

Tax Component Annual Amount Effective Rate
Gross Salary (Median) $69,100
Federal Income Tax -$7,043 10.2%
Arizona State Income Tax -$1,727 2.5%
Social Security (OASDI) -$4,284 6.2%
Medicare -$1,001 1.5%
Total Taxes -$14,056 20.3%
Take-Home Pay $55,043 79.7%

How is Conservation Scientists take-home pay in Arizona calculated?

We start with the 2024 BLS median salary of $69,100 for Conservation Scientists in Arizona, then subtract: federal income tax using 2024 IRS brackets ($14,600 standard deduction), Arizona state income tax (2.5% flat rate), Social Security (6.2% up to $168,600), and Medicare (1.45%). The result — $55,043/yr — does not include local taxes, pre-tax deductions (401k, HSA), or tax credits.

Tax Calculation Assumptions

This estimate assumes a single filer using the 2024 standard deduction ($14,600), with W-2 employment income only. It does not account for: itemized deductions, tax credits (e.g. earned income credit, child tax credit), local/city taxes, pre-tax contributions (401k, HSA, FSA), self-employment tax, or additional income sources. Actual take-home pay may differ. Consult a tax professional for personalized advice.
